Good things to know

Which word is more common?

Repainting is more commonly used than refinishing in everyday language, as it is a simpler and more common process. However, refinishing is more commonly used in the context of furniture restoration or renovation.

Whatโ€™s the difference in the tone of formality between repainting and refinishing?

Both repainting and refinishing can be used in formal and informal contexts, depending on the situation and audience. However, refinishing may be considered more formal due to its association with furniture restoration and renovation.
